SK-OV-3 Cell Line:
Ovarian cancer is considered the fifth primary cause of cancer deaths among women, accounting for more fatalities than any other type of cancer in females. Ovarian cancer mostly occurs in older Caucasian women over 60 years old and is one of the deadliest gynecological malignancy worldwide, as indicated by the American Cancer Society. Although ovarian cancer incidence rates have been consistently declining over the last decade, new treatment approaches are required to improve survival rates of those affected. The SK-OV-3 tumorigenic epithelial cell line was isolated in 1973 from the ovarian tissue of a 64-year-old Caucasian female with adenocarcinoma. SK-OV-3 cells have been known to be resistant to tumor necrosis, as well as several other cytotoxic drugs such as Adriamycin, cis-platinum, and diphtheria toxin. The SK-OV-3 cell line is hypodiploid and a suitable transfection host for ovarian cancer research. Altogen Biosystems offers pre-optimized lipid-based transfection kits for SK-OV-3 cells.
Data:
Figure 1. Cyclophilin B silencing efficiency was determined by qRT-PCR in the SKOV3 cells transfected by Cyclophilin B siRNA or non-silencing siRNA control following the recommended transfection protocol. Cyclophilin mRNA expression levels were measured 48 hours post-transfection. 18S rRNA levels were used to normalize the Cyclophilin B data. Values are normalized to untreated sample. Data are presented as means ± SD (n=6).
Figure 2. Protein expression of Cyclophilin B in SK-OV-3 cells. DNA plasmid expressing Cyclophilin B or siRNA targeting Cyclophilin B were transfected into SK-OV-3 cells following Altogen Biosystems transfection protocol. At 72 hours post-transfection the cells were analyzed by Western Blot for protein expression levels (normalized by total protein, 10 µg of total protein loaded per each well). Untreated cells used as a negative control.
